30-Hour Childcare Funding
If you are applying for a funded Nursery place using a 30-hour eligibility code, HMRC recommends applying by 31 July before your child's September start.
Please provide your eligibility code to the school as soon as you receive it. Funding cannot be claimed until a valid code has been received.

In-Year Admissions (Years R–6)
In -Year Admissions are admissions during the school year or into year groups other than Nursery and Reception.
We currently have places available in some year groups and operate waiting lists where year groups are full.
Please contact the school office to discuss availability or to arrange a visit.

Children with SEND
At Dorchester Primary School, we are proud of our inclusive ethos and are committed to helping every child belong, learn and thrive.
If your child has Special Educational Needs and/or Disabilities (SEND) and you are considering our Nursery or school, we strongly encourage you to contact us before your child starts.
Our SENDCO, Suzanne Rankin, would be delighted to meet with you to discuss your child's strengths, needs and the support we can provide.

Transition planning for children with SEND begins as soon as places have been accepted to ensure every child has the best possible start.
Parents may also find independent advice helpful through Sutton Information, Advice and Support Service (SIASS), which provides free, confidential and impartial guidance for families of children with SEND.
